Sarah Palin criticized ESPN for firing sportscaster Curt Schilling over a post he shared on Facebook opposing transgender people using bathrooms that don’t correspond to their biological sex.

Palin wrote in Facebook post Thursday, “ESPN continues to screw up” with a link to a Hollywood Reporter article about Schilling’s firing, and a meme that said “Fundamentally Transforming America -B. Obama.”

Schilling had posted on his social media account a picture of a man wearing a blond wig, ripped clothing that showed his chest and belly, in stockings and heels. Alongside the photo read the message “LET HIM IN! to the restroom with your daughter or else you’re a narrow-minded, judgmental, unloving racist bigot who needs to die.”

The post was later deleted.

Wednesday the sports channel issued the following the statement: “Curt Schilling has been advised that his conduct was unacceptable and his employment with ESPN has been terminated,” as reported here.

Last year Schilling was suspended after sharing a post on social media comparing ISIS to Nazis.
